(4-甲酰基苯氧基)乙酸甲酯 | 73620-18-5

中文名称
(4-甲酰基苯氧基)乙酸甲酯
中文别名
——
英文名称
methyl (4-formylphenoxy)acetate
英文别名
methyl 2-(4-formylphenoxy)acetate;4-(Methoxycarbonylmethoxy)benzaldehyde
(4-甲酰基苯氧基)乙酸甲酯化学式
CAS
73620-18-5
化学式
C10H10O4
mdl
MFCD00463122
分子量
194.187
InChiKey
TVJPCDPSAWVMHA-UHFFFAOYSA-N
BEILSTEIN
——
EINECS
——

物化性质

  • 熔点:
    40-42 °C
  • 沸点:
    315.2±17.0 °C(Predicted)
  • 密度:
    1.201±0.06 g/cm3(Predicted)

计算性质

  • 辛醇/水分配系数(LogP):
    0.9
  • 重原子数:
    14
  • 可旋转键数:
    5
  • 环数:
    1.0
  • sp3杂化的碳原子比例:
    0.2
  • 拓扑面积:
    52.6
  • 氢给体数:
    0
  • 氢受体数:
    4

安全信息

  • 危险等级:
    IRRITANT
  • 海关编码:
    2918990090
  • 危险性防范说明:
    P261,P280,P305+P351+P338
  • 危险性描述:
    H302,H315,H319,H332,H335
  • 储存条件:
    温度:2-8°C,环境为惰性气体氛围。

  • 作为产物:
    描述:
    溴乙酸甲酯potassium carbonate 、 potassium iodide 作用下, 以 DMF (N,N-dimethyl-formamide) 为溶剂, 反应 4.0h, 生成 (4-甲酰基苯氧基)乙酸甲酯
